在windows下使用python进行串口通讯的方法
2019-07-02 21:09
896 查看
Windows版本下的python并没有内置串口通讯的pyserial的库,所以需要自己下载。参照了网上的教程,有许多用的pip的安装方式,但是试了几个都没有用,所以想到用GitHub下载库文件,步骤分为:
1.在Github下载python-serial的库
https://github.com/pyserial/pyserial
2.下载完成后解压压缩包,找到serial文件夹,并找到python的安装位置(右击IDLE,然后查看python安装位置)。我的地址为:C:\Users\NI YINTANG\AppData\Local\Programs\Python\Python36
3.进入Python36\Lib\site-packages,并将刚才的serial文件夹复制进site-packages中。
4.打开IDLE,在Shell中输入Import serial,如果不报错,即为安装完成。
5.下面进行测试连接的端口,在程序中输入以下程序并运行,即可找到连接电脑的端口:
import serial import serial.tools.list_ports plist = list(serial.tools.list_ports.comports()) if len(plist) <= 0: print ("The Serial port can't find!") else: plist_0 =list(plist[0]) serialName = plist_0[0] serialFd = serial.Serial(serialName,9600,timeout = 60) print ("check which port was really used >",serialFd.name)
以上这篇在windows下使用python进行串口通讯的方法就是小编分享给大家的全部内容了,希望能给大家一个参考
您可能感兴趣的文章:
相关文章推荐
- windows下使用python进行串口通讯
- Win10下python3和python2同时安装并解决pip共存问题 特别说明,本文是在Windows64位系统下进行的,32位系统请下载相应版本的安装包,安装方法类似。 使用python开
- 使用python进行windows自动化测试
- Windows和Linux下使用Python访问SqlServer的方法介绍
- Python使用系统聚类方法进行数据分类案例一则
- windows下使用virtualenv进行多版本python共存
- 使用Mixin设计模式进行Python编程的方法讲解
- Python从excel读取数据,并使用scipy进行散点的平滑曲线化方法
- Windows下安装Redis及使用Python操作Redis的方法
- Windows和Linux下使用Python访问SqlServer的方法介绍
- Python中使用Queue和Condition进行线程同步的方法
- 使用Python进行二进制文件读写的简单方法(推荐)
- windows下python,使用笔记本摄像头进行连续截图,并进行灰度、二值化处理
- Windows上使用Python增加或删除权限的方法
- windows下python3.6使用face_recognition进行人脸识别
- Python使用matplotlib,numpy,scipy进行散点的平滑曲线化方法
- python使用socket进行简单网络连接的方法
- python使用WMI检测windows系统信息、硬盘信息、网卡信息的方法
- 图文介绍Windows系统下使用 Github账户 + msysgit + TortoiseGit 进行文件管理的方法。
- 使用Mixin设计模式进行Python编程的方法讲解